我们有Conversation视图,因为我们将收到消息并发布消息,因为我需要电子邮件ID或web url的超链接,如果是联系号码,它也是超链接,当点击它导航到呼叫拨号器与联系号码一起,它应该在文本块中,例如:如同在Windows Phone中的消息(sms)..
答案 0 :(得分:0)
您应该使用RichTextBox
。在RichTextBox
中,您可以使用超链接显示链接文字。
您需要使用URL Regex解析文本以构建超链接和文本块。
private static readonly Regex _parseUrls = new Regex(@"http(s)?://([A-Za-z0-9./]*)", RegexOptions.IgnoreCase);
您还可以查看this post
希望这会有所帮助。